Independent · Mymensingh-1
Mohammad Salman Omar is actively pressuring the government to resolve the severe electricity crisis and load-shedding affecting his constituency.
Sent a formal letter to the Minister for Power, Energy and Mineral Resources regarding severe load-shedding in Mymensingh-1.
Participated in a parliamentary question-and-answer session regarding the Family Card allowance programme.

Vote counts from BSS official result page (108,265 vs 101,926; total valid 264,673 across 143 centres); Prothom Alo and New Age carried slightly different informal tallies (107,241 vs 100,736) from earlier count stages. BSS figures used as primary official source. Vote share percentages derived: 108265/264673 = 40.91%; 101926/264673 = 38.51%; margin = 2.40 pp. Salman Omar Rubel ran under the Motorcycle symbol. He is a first-time MP who won in his first-ever election. Prior BNP roles confirmed: Joint Convener BNP Mymensingh North District, and Dhobaura Upazila BNP President (Bangla sources: unnayansangbad.com, bssnews.net Bangla). He was expelled from BNP in January 2026. EC affidavit (wealth, income, criminal cases) not published in any accessible source as of verification date; fields left null per EC-only schema rule. Age, education, occupation: not reported in any available source; left null. 13th parliament oath: February 17, 2026 (all elected MPs). Registered voters: 483,712 (241,604 men, 242,104 women, 4 hijras) per ViewsBangladesh pre-election report.
